We are so excited to interview the paranormal podcaster himself, Jim Harold. Another Northeast Ohio paranormal podcaster, Jim Harold is a podcasting pioneer - starting all the way back in 2005.
In this interview, we get into why he got into podcasting, some of his favorite stories, any campfire stories that were less than believable to him, retro causality, and more.
Jim Harold hosts the Paranormal Podcast along with Jim Harold's Campfire.
Additionally, Jim Harold releases books that include stories told to him on the Jim Harold's Campfire Podcast, and his newest book - Volume 6 - just dropped May 7th, 2024.
